#c49702 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#c49702 is composed of 76.9% red, 59.2%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 23% magenta, 99% yellow and 23.1% black. It has a hue angle of 46.1 degrees, a saturation of 98% and a lightness of 38.8%. #c49702 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ff04 with #892f00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

#c49702 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#c49702 has RGB values of R:196, G:151,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.23, Y:0.99,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 12883714.

Shades and Tints of #c49702
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020100 is the darkest color, while #fffbed is the lightest one.

Tones of #c49702
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#69665d is the less saturated color, while #c49702 is the most saturated one.
